Pekiti-Tirsia is an attack system of combat proven strategy, tactics and techniques executed through the principle of offense, counter-offense, and “recounter”-offense.
Training will provide students with clear and concise knowledge, understanding, and skills in fighting and its application with all edges/impact/empty-hand weapons. Learn the keys to applying effective combat technique through the Pekiti-Tirsia system.
A true, authentic family system of Filipino martial arts, tested and proven through generations of combat and utilized now by the elite Philippine Force Recon Marines, and numerous other Military/Law Enforcement and Private Security groups around the world. Pekiti-Tirsia is the only system recognized by the Philippine government used to train Force Recon Marine Battalions of the Armed Forces of the Philippines and the Special Action Force (SAF) contingent of the Philippine National Police.
All fighting ranges are integral parts of the Pekiti-Tirsia system, but special attention is given to the close-quarter fighting. Pekiti-Tirsia is about quartering the opponent, or ‘cutting up into little pieces’ total destruction with counter offense while not getting hit Pekiti-Tirsia is a true martial art to defend yourself, or family. It is not a sport.
The Pekiti-Tirsia methodology originates from offensive and counter offensive principles against attacks from all ranges, angles and threat levels. there are no separate or specific defensive techniques as such, as the Pekiti-Tirsia man is always seeking ways to end the conflict.
This martial art fighting style is currently experiencing a rise in popularity because: a loose version of the fighting style is used by Matt Damon in the Jason Bourne series of films, and The History Channel’s Human Weapon and The Discovery Channel’s Fight Quest documentaries on the art of Pekiti-Tirsia.

What is Aikido?
Aikido is a traditional Japanese martial art created in the early 20th century by Morihei Ueshiba and the art form teaches self defense in a unique way. An Aikido practioner ( Aikidoka ) will blend or harmonize with an attack & use dynamic circular movements to unbalance the attacker. Then, rather than using potentially crippling kicks or punches, the Aikidoka can apply an endless variety of joint-locks, pins or unbalancing throws to render an attacker harmless without causing serios injury.
The name Aikido is composed of three Japanese characters:
Ai - meaning harmony
Ki - Spirit or energy
Do - Path or way.
Aikido is The Way of Spiritual Harmony. Aikido teaches you to be flexible, fluid and centered in any situation and to move spontaneously within its principles. An Aikidoka learns to unite body, mind & spirit.
